A Sarladais sentenced to having sold tobacco illegally
-

If the tough tobacco sellers remain the prerogative of major cities, the traffic in cigarettes does not spare the rural departments like the Dordogne. This was noted by the Bergerac court on Tuesday, May 6, where a 34 -year -old Sarladais was tried for fraudulent tobacco detention for sale.

The man was arrested in Sarlat, at the end of November 2024; The gendarmes had used a pseudonym on Snapchat to order three cartridges. This meeting, fixed in the Carrefour car park in Sarlat, had not succeeded, the thirty-something feeling that these customers were not quite like the others. During the search carried out then at his home, 44 Marlboro cartridges were entered as well as 11,800 euros in .

“Profitable” trafficking

“I a cardboard of 50 cartridges via social networks in Périgueux, ten days earlier,” explains the accused. I sold the cartridge at 60 euros and the package at 10. I had just opened my grocery store, I was afraid of not being able to assume the charges of my business. As with narcotic drugs, the uberization of cigarette traffic has exploded from the covid. “The announcements were multiplied by three or even four on the networks,” notes Daniel Bruquel who fights against traffic at Philip Morris France, civil party in the . Cities or countryside no territory is spared. »»

Especially since traffic would be particularly “profitable”. In France, it would represent, according to figures from Daniel Bruquel, 2.5 billion euros. “Regarding tobacco traffic, we are overwhelmed,” confirmed the customs representative at the hearing. Asked about the money at home, the defendant ensures that only a few hundred euros come from the sale. “I had 10,000 euros in ,” explains the 30 -year -old who has 10 mentions in the locker for drug trafficking or road crimes.

See you on May 15

Civil party, the tobacconists’ federation underlined the “shortfall” for professionals but also moral damage. “A tobacconist earns between 1,200 and 1,500 euros per month and affects 10 cents on a package,” illustrated the lawyer who claimed 538 euros in material damage and 2,000 euros for the moral damage.

But for the defense, it is not a large -scale traffic. “We are told about public health but in any case, smoking kills,” said Raygade highlighting “the enameled life of painful events” of his client. The magistrates decided to follow the requisitions of the prosecution by condemning the Sarladais to nine months in prison with the possibility of development. In addition, he will have to pay 7,715 euros , 4,798 euros in and , 2,000 euros in tax fine and 5,000 euros in penalty. The man will also owe 1,038 euros to the federation of tobacconists and 900 euros to Philip Morris France.

The civil parties will meet on Thursday, May 15 in Bergerac: a couple will have to answer for detention and sale of tobacco in organized gang and money laundering between January 2022 and April 2025. It is estimated that they were selling “at least 200 cartridges per week”, the customs fine was calculated at 2 million euros.
